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•Being over 60 years old
- •Having MCR syndrome
- •Willingness to participate in the study
Exclusion Criteria
- •Suffering from dementia (previous diagnosis or identification in cognitive screening)
- •Having progressive neurological diseases such as Parkinson's disease
- •Significant vision and/or hearing loss that affects the person's mobility
- •Current diagnosis or history of psychiatric disorders
- •Recent or anticipated medical procedures that may affect the elderly person's mobility.
- •Having a disease affecting the study process
- •Unwillingness to cooperate or death or migration
